OUR EDITORIAL REVIEW

Packaging:

The “Calendula Herbal Extract Toner” comes in a plastic cylindrical bottle that is transparent and has a white flip-cap. The product information is written in black and golden yellow on a large white label. Because of the transparent nature of the bottle, the bottle appears pale yellow because of the color of the toner itself which can be seen-through. Real calendula petals are also seen floating inside.

Skin Type:

This toner is suitable for normal and oily skin.

Texture:

The toner has a watery-runny texture.

Smell:

The smell of this toner is herbal and flowery, almost like a tea smell. However, the fragrance is mild and goes away a few moments after application.

Application:

After cleansing the face, apply the “Calendula Herbal Extract Toner” on a cotton pad to dampen it. Then, tap the areas of the face that need toning with the cotton pad. Avoid the eye area and follow-up with a hydrating moisturizer.

Effect:

The central ingredient in this Kiehl’s toner is Calendula which is another name for Marigold. This plant has been shown to have anti-inflammatory and anti-viral properties and is a popular ingredient in some cosmetic products. We tested this toner on sensitive skin and found that it had no stinging or tingling feeling on the skin. Instead, we found it to have hydrating qualities and an overall soothing effect. After application, the skin felt refreshed. There was no irritation or redness caused by the toner which calmed the skin very nicely. The “Calendula Herbal Extract Toner” is not greasy and regulates the skin’s oil levels by controlling the skin’s oil production. However, given that skin types may vary, this product may not be suitable for acne-prone skin. Even with its alcohol-free feature, the skin may be aggravated by this toner. So, it is best to consult a professional if your skin is prone to acne so as to not irritate it.

Price:

The “Calendula Herbal Extract Toner” comes in three sizes and prices: $21/125 mL; $35/250 mL; and $62/500 mL. The price is fair considering that other toners run in the sam price range. In fact, Lancôme’s “Tonique Confort Comforting Rehydrating Toner” retails at $26/200 mL and Origin’s “Zero Oil Pore Purifying Toner with Saw Palmetto and Mint” sells for $23/150 mL.
